    John Buckley is a professor of military history whose work delves into the conflicts and air power of the twentieth century. His writings are characterized by a deep immersion in military history, exploring the strategic utilization of air power and the implications of total war. Buckley's analyses offer readers an informed perspective on the evolution of military strategy and tactics during a pivotal period of history.
